## Westmere Expansion — Managers Only

Welcome aboard! This page covers our push into the Westmere coastal region. Short version: demand for the Larkspur product line there has outpaced every forecast, and we've secured two depot sites near Port Ellin. Staffing plans are drafted but flexible, so bring your own thinking to the kickoff. Before your first leadership sync, read the confidential business plan note below.

internal memo for fajog-yagaf: Gross margin on Ulaael came in at 20 percent against a plan of 10 percent. Only 9 of the 80 pilot accounts renewed Ulaael, so a churn review is set for July 1.

## Onboarding: Thumbcache Leak in Veldrome

New reviewers: the image cache in the Veldrome gallery service leaks roughly 40MB/hour under sustained thumbnail churn. Root cause is eviction callbacks never firing when the Orlix decoder throws mid-frame. A patch is in review; meanwhile we cap the cache and restart nightly via the Brindlewatch cron. Profiling requires the heap-dump endpoint enabled, which needs the diagnostics env configured locally. Copy the staging env file, then add the diagnostics access credential directly below this line.

env line for fafof-fahag: LEDGER_TOKEN5=f8790

**Ticket #4182 — Retention sweeper blocked by locked vault**

Welcome aboard. The Driftwell retention sweeper failed its nightly run because the Corvane vault sealed itself after three failed token renewals. Please follow the unseal steps in the contractor handbook carefully and verify each node before retrying the sweep. To unseal, you will need the recovery passphrase below.

unlock words, kahog-hahop: zordor-casael-jorath-druius-kasok

Handover for the assistants' rota — from Priya to Callum. The basement archive at Densmore Wharf is our responsibility on alternating weeks. Team assistants fetch files for the legal group; requests come through the Harkbell tracker. Allow 24 hours for retrievals and always refile by close of day Friday. The trolley lives behind the stairwell door. Heating down there is poor, so keep visits short. The archive door keypad takes the standard code, which is as follows.

door code, yagap-bahof: bdg-O-05